Any chance to review the qls against the other two?


To my like, HM901 with balance amp card still is the best sounding DAP among these three. I am not sure was it due to the limitation of AMP section of QLS QA360 or MR Chen's preference, 360's base is not as fast and punchy as HM901's. Over all QA360 is roughly at the same level compare with HM901/ DX100. QA360's biggest advantage is it's battery life is about 11-12 hrs. I started playing nonstop from 6am this morning, now it is 13:25 local time, battery indicator still shows 40% remain. I will let you know the exact time 360 last from one charge. Another point is battery is 5v so portable USB charger will do the job.
UI is very simple and straight, no cover art or anything fancy. Lightening fast boot up- 1 sec or so. I only have 32g SD card, insert and ready to play in 1 sec.

Flac does not support 24/96, 24/192, no problem with WAV hires files
 
Jun 4, 2014 at 7:09 PM Post #60 of 753
I am listening A Book Like This by Angus & Julia Stone with HD650 plug in QA360. Sound pretty nice, volume at 102, HD650 sounds well driven. I can feel the change of BASS department in past three days of burn in . Bass was in decline first day of burn in, but came back now with better depth and the quantity is just right to my ears. The best synergy with headphones was with my Grado PS500. Volume at 95, PS500 sound really amazing.
